Pita Maker/Cashier
I dropped off my resume in person and got a call the same day about an interview. The interview was also scheduled for that same day and I was hired right then and there.
- What makes you want this job?
- What are you good at and not so good at?
- Can you share an experience where you had a disagreement with someone at work and explain how you resolved it?
Pita Maker/Cashier
The interview was very straightforward, I met at the restaurant and interviewed on the spot. The interviewer asked if I used a POS system and what my availability was like and if I had worked in the food industry before.
- Did you have experience with a POS system?
- What is your availability like?
- Have you worked in the food industry before?
IT Manager
First, an introductory call, then a second round with in-depth analysis, reviewing past records, job relevance, your understanding of the company's core products, and how you match company needs within timelines. Finally, offer negotiation with the HR team.
- How do you see yourself adding value to meet these requirements?
- Can you describe your contributions to this role?
- What's your grasp of our product suite?
